New 2022 Mobilize Limo unveiled with focus on car-sharing

Renault’s new Mobilize sub-brand has revealed the first of its four car-sharing models - the Limo

Renault car-sharing sub-brand Mobilize has revealed the Limo - a car intended for taxi firms, private hire drivers and fleet managers - ahead of its official world premiere at the 2021 Munich Motor Show.

The new Limo is the first of the four vehicles planned by the Mobilze brand - cars called Bento, Duo, Hippo are also planned - and it’s a coupe-SUV with a fully electric powertrain. 

The Limo only comes with a 60kWh battery, while its electric motor system generates 148bhp and 220Nm, giving the Limo a 0-62mph time of 9.6 seconds and a top speed of 87mph.

What will be more important to the taxi drivers and businesses Mobilize is targeting is the range and charging capacity. To this end, Mobilize claims it has a maximum range of 280 miles and can recharge 150 miles in 40 minutes. Drivers can choose between three driving modes - Normal, Eco and Sport. Regenerative braking can also be set to different levels.

The MobIlize Limo is a similar size to the Tesla Model 3, measuring 24mm shorter in length, 19mm narrower in width while being 34mm taller. Inside, there’s a 10.25-inch screen for the instrument panel, while a 12.3-inch touchscreen features in the centre of the dashboard. 

There’s also a fridge between the two front seats. Volume controls, USB ports and a flat floor in the rear hint at the Limo’s intended use as a ride-hailing car. Due to its sloped coupe-style roof, the boot space stands at 411 litres, some way off the 543 litres the Volkswagen ID.4 and 527 litres the Ioniq 5 offer. 

There are three colours available, Metallic Black, Metallic Grey and Glossy White. The Limo comes with 17-inch alloy wheels as standard along with LED headlights, scrolling indicators and flush door handles that pop out when unlocked. 

Mobilize has developed an app specifically for the Limo which provides all the car’s information and can be used to remotely access the car’s location and certain features, such as locking/unlocking the doors, setting the climate and scheduling charging times.

There’s no typical ‘on-the-road’ price for the Mobilize Limo, as the car will be available exclusively through a flex-rate subscription-based offer for professional drivers beginning from the second half of 2022.
